US SB2934
Bill
AI Summary
-
Prohibits enforcement of foreign court judgments or arbitral awards in U.S. federal or state courts when the underlying claim arose from compliance with U.S. sanctions or export controls
-
Allows defendants to remove such enforcement actions to federal district court, which must dismiss them
-
Preserves rights of terrorism victims, torture victims, and hostage-taking victims who are U.S. nationals, military members, or government employees to pursue claims under existing laws
-
Protects contractual rights where parties agreed to resolve disputes through U.S. litigation or arbitration, and other claims arising under U.S. law related to sanctions compliance
-
Applies to civil actions pending on or after the date of enactment, introduced September 29, 2025 by Senators Cornyn and Padilla
Legislative Description
Protecting Americans from Russian Litigation Act of 2025
International affairs
Last Action
Read twice and referred to the Committee on the Judiciary.
9/29/2025
